Q: Is 6,852,220 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,852,220 is a composite number.

Why is 6,852,220 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,852,220 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 397 794 863 1,588 1,726 1,985 3,452 3,970 4,315 7,940 8,630 17,260 342,611 685,222 1,370,444 1,713,055 3,426,110 and 6,852,220, with no remainder.

Since 6,852,220 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,852,220, it is a composite number.
